243.340. Privilege to pay drainage tax in full. — The owner of any land or other property taxed for the construction of any improvement under the provisions of this chapter, shall have the privilege of paying such tax to the county treasurer at any time on or before a date to be fixed by the county commission prior to the issuance of bonds payable from said taxes and the amount to be paid shall be the full amount of the tax levied, less any amount added thereto to meet interest.
He shall present the treasurer's receipt therefor to the county clerk, who shall enter upon the drainage tax record opposite each tract for which payment is made the words "paid in full" and such tax shall be deemed satisfied.
­­--------
(RSMo 1939 § 12414)
Prior revisions: 1929 § 10825; 1919 § 4493
